Charleswood is in northwest Calgary with local access from Charleswood Drive, Northmount Drive, John Laurie Boulevard, 19 Street NW, 24 Avenue NW, and nearby Crowchild Trail connections. These routes connect residential areas with the University of Calgary area, Nose Hill Park, neighbouring communities, and major northwest Calgary roads.
From Brentwood, Charleswood Drive and Northmount Drive provide direct local connections toward Charleswood. From Dalhousie and Varsity, Crowchild Trail and Shaganappi Trail provide useful routes toward the community.
John Laurie Boulevard is one of the most recognizable reference routes near Charleswood, while Crowchild Trail provides a major north-south connection through northwest Calgary. These roads are useful landmarks when describing the location of a disabled vehicle.
